Zusammenfassung

Exploring various forms of contemporary mass art and culture, from rock-'n'-roll music to "slasher" films, from women's romances to "retro" fashion style, these essays reflect the paradox inherent in taking a critical approach to mass culture. This text offers an array of essays explaining important facets of contemporary culture.

Studies in Entertainment: Critical Approaches to Mass Culture Tania Modleski

"This is an important book for all students of literature and history." -American Studies International

" . . . thoughtful and provocative. . . . the essays . . . grant complexity and contradiction to mass culture, while interrogating its objects from positions that-explicitly or implicitly-derive from the left and from feminism." -The Independent

These innovative and politically engaged essays reflect the paradox inherent in taking a critical approach to mass culture.

The contributors, in many cases pioneers in their particular area of inquiry, include: Tania Modleski, Raymond Williams (interviewed here by Stephen Heath and Gillian Skirrow), Bernard Gendron, Rick Altman, Margaret Morse, Patricia Mellencamp, Judith Williamson, Jean Franco, Kaja Silverman, Dana Polan, and Andreas Huyssen.
